204 listings
$ 29,999
3,810 miles
Urbandale, IA
$ 34,999
10,455 miles
$ 7,999
172,911 miles
$ 13,499
98,330 miles
$ 32,095
NEW
$ 42,999
11,392 miles
$ 35,310
$ 17,999
60,165 miles
$ 14,999
137,672 miles
$ 12,499
115,488 miles
$ 10,999
137,322 miles
$ 31,995
$ 24,999
70,820 miles
$ 19,999
79,024 miles
$ 27,999
0 miles
47,651 miles
$ 27,499
102,555 miles
$ 40,330
$ 16,999
93,881 miles
$ 9,999
165,388 miles
$ 17,499
51,961 miles
74,798 miles
$ 12,999
61,226 miles
$ 44,999
16,455 miles
$ 35,999
7,838 miles
$ 34,730
$ 32,650
2,405 miles